I made a little crawler to process some intranet documents .Working with the 
latest version of Droids I was testing the behaviour with errors. And the 
problem is that the HttpClient pool don't release the conections after a status 
code 500 from the server.

Reading the documentation for HttpClient (1.1.5), found that is needed to 
release the resources. 

Index: src/main/java/org/apache/droids/protocol/http/HttpProtocol.java
===================================================================
--- src/main/java/org/apache/droids/protocol/http/HttpProtocol.java     
(revision 810841)
+++ src/main/java/org/apache/droids/protocol/http/HttpProtocol.java     
(working copy)
@@ -63,6 +63,7 @@
     HttpResponse response = httpclient.execute(httpget);
     StatusLine statusline = response.getStatusLine();
     if (statusline.getStatusCode() != HttpStatus.SC_OK) {
+      httpget.abort();
       throw new HttpResponseException(
           statusline.getStatusCode(), statusline.getReasonPhrase());
     }
